Boot Mobility Scooter

A boot scooter is a great alternative for those who have limited mobility. They are easy to get into and out of the car, and are also suitable for use on pavements.

Boot scooters are available in three- and four-wheeled versions. There are foldable versions as well.

Easy to dismantle

A boot mobility scooter is a class 2 scooter that folds or dismantled to fit into the Car Boot Ramp For Mobility Scooter's boot. They are very popular and can be taken apart in just a few seconds which makes them perfect for those with limited mobility.

These scooters are usually made out of aluminum and can be extremely light, making them easy to dismantle for transport. To disassemble the mobility scooter start by removing the battery pack and seat. Then, split the chassis of the scooter into two.

This is a hefty scooter, so you'll need to take care. This can be quite a tricky job and you should always follow the manufacturer's instructions to ensure that you're doing it safely. After you've separated the scooter, put it in the car boot as soon as possible to prevent it from getting damaged.

After you have put your scooter in your car, make sure it is positioned correctly to avoid damaging your vehicle or scratching the paintwork. Start by placing the rear section first followed by the front section and then the seat and battery pack.

Easy to transport

Mobility scooters from Boot can be an excellent alternative to a vehicle for those who prefer to move around cities or towns independently. They can be broken down into smaller pieces so that they're easy to transport from one location to another. They can be put in the boot of your car so you can transport them wherever you need to go.

The majority of boot mobility scooters are four or three wheeled and feature a tiller steering mechanism, making them a great choice for people who have restricted mobility in their legs. This allows them to move more freely and travel further than a manual or powered wheelchair.

Some of these scooters are airline-friendly and offer a huge advantage if you intend to travel by air. This scooter from FreeRider is one example. It can fold flatly into flat and can be lifted onto an aircraft without issue whatsoever! It is also TSA certified, which means it is a perfect choice for anyone looking to go on a vacation.

You'll need to determine the space in your boot due to the fact that different kinds of mobility scooters differ in weight. It is recommended to lay a blanket over the floor of your boot, as this will protect the paintwork of the bumper on the back and will help you to move your mobility scooter into and out of your car. It is best car boot mobility scooter to put the scooter's rear part in the boot first, followed by the front.

This is a very simple process and you should be able to do it yourself with minimal assistance. It is always a smart idea to check your manual for any necessary instructions.

Easy to store

If you keep your mobility aid in your garage, or in the trunk of your car, there's a few simple steps you can follow to ensure that it is in good shape. First, make sure that your battery pack is recharged. Batteries may begin to lose power if you don't charge them. Keep your scooter in a location that is dry and won't get rusty. Also keep it out of the way and don't store it too tightly.

The control panel of your mobility scooter must be kept dry and clean. Wipe down the controls after each use to prevent dirt from accumulating. This will ensure that your scooter remains in good working order and lasts longer.

The latest models are easy to take apart. The majority of them have a lever that can lift the scooter between the front and back parts so that you can access the battery pack.

When the battery pack is removed, it's a good idea to place a blanket on top of the frame to shield it from paintwork scratches and scratches and ensure your scooter is in great condition. The next step is to put the most heavy part of the scooter inside your boot. Once everything is set then you can begin to reassemble the scooter.

If you're unsure about how to dismantle your scooter, it's always a good idea to read the manual for owners. It should include clear photos showing how to do it safely and in a proper manner.

The most reliable boot scooters will have a good steering mechanism, so that you can steer easily and be comfortable to ride. Some boot scooters are equipped with a regenerative braking system that allows them to stop on slopes without you having to release the brakes. This is a wonderful security feature.

These scooters can be folded down and disassembled to be transported in the back of a car which makes them easy to transport and put away. Some scooters come in one unit that can be folded to a smaller size. Others may need to be dismantled into several parts, and then rebuilt when you're ready.

A lot of them can be driven on pavements and are suitable for indoor use. They're the most commonly used type of scooters and they're available in a range of prices.

If you're looking for an alternative to your vehicle that will be used daily, you should look at a Class 3 Mobility Scooter. They can be used on roads, but they'll need to come with full indicators and lights.
